Noun
Morrisite (plural Morrisites)
- (historical, Mormonism) A follower of Joseph Morris, the English-born American leader of a schismatic Mormon movement called Church of the Firstborn that expected an imminent Second Coming.
- (historical, politics) A follower of Lewis Morris, an American revolutionary and Federalist politician.
- (historical, politics) A follower of William Morris, a British anarchist socialist and Romantic artist associated with the Arts and Crafts movement.
